#368f00 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#368f00 is composed of 21.2% red, 56.1% green and 0%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 62.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 100% yellow and 43.9% black. It has a hue angle of 97.3 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 28%. #368f00 color hex could be obtained by blending #6cff00 with #001f00. Closest websafe color is: #339900.

#368f00 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#368f00 has RGB values of R:54, G:143, B:0 and CMYK values of C:0.62, M:0, Y:1, K:0.44. Its decimal value is 3575552.
